A Roman copper-alloy nummus of Valens dating to the period AD 367 to 378 (Reece period 19). GLORIA ROMANORVM reverse type depicting Emperor advancing right dragging captive and holding standard. Possibly Mint of Trier. Mintmark: -//TRP
Cf. LRBC p. 47, no. 100.
Obverse: [...]S P F AVG; Pearl-diademed, draped and cuirassed bust right
Reverse: [GLORIA ROMANORVM]; Soldier advancing right dragging captive and holding standard
Diameter: 16.7mm. Weight: 2.41g. DA=12:12.
